McKenzie won the toss last night and deferred...UC took the opening kick-off and drove straight down the field like they have been doing the last few weeks....Missed the PAT and was up 6-0....McKenzie got the ball and fumbled...Union City recovered and had the ball on McKenzie's 38 yard line...Maybe the turning point of the game was that McKenzie held the Tornadoes without a first down on that series....McKenzie then was able to start gashing the UC line and getting big chunks of yardage with Johnson....McKenzie didn't pass too many times but they showed the possibilty of it...McKinney would line up in the shotgun and scramble around or run a draw and that would kind of keep UC's rush at bay...UC also lost contain on the ends a few times and allowed some yardage around the flanks...McKenzie actually missed a FG that would have brought them within 6-3 but their defense was holding Union City and then also,UC would fumble or run into each other in the backfield which would bog down drives...In UC's offense,timing is everything.....I had a bad feeling about this game as the game got closer because of the weather forecast....A wet field hampers the timing of the offense..The backs are slower to the ball and to the fakes...It just gets everything out of sync...Union City made some good adjustments at half because they were able to move the ball better starting in the third quarter....The second half was a field position game...I thought the last two scoring drives showed what these two teams are all about....Union City down since the second quarter and their season on the line puts together a solid drive and goes down the field and scores..Colton Speed breaks loose and goes on a 45 yard run....Then with McKenzie's season on the line the Rebels put together their own season saving series of plays...A lot of courage and heart shown on those two drives....

From what I have been reading and listening to, this will be the last time Union City & McKenzie could play each other in a playoff game but will play in the regular season.

 

Union City will stay Single A during the regular season and playoffs while McKenzie will be in the Single division in the regular season but move up to AA during the playoffs.

 

Then after the next 4 years, with the enrollment Union City has in the Middle School and to first grade , we will be back up to AA.
